WebA phoropter or refractor is an ophthalmic testing device. WebApr 22, 2024 · The interactive Retinoscopy Simulator is designed for students to learn and practice the principles of retinoscopy. Visualize how light reflexes in an eye with various refractive errors and amounts of astigmatism, and from various working distances. The simulator allows adjustment of spherical power, cylinder power, and cylinder axis.
